    'Mavic To Develop into Premium Full Cycling Brand'

    ANNECY, France - Amer Sports has completed its divestment of Mavic SAS. The Finnish sporting goods manufacturer has finalized the sale of its French bike subsidiary to private equity firm Regent LP.

    ZEG to Pay Millions in Fines for Price-Fixing

    BONN, Germany - Germany's national competition authority (Bundeskartellamt) announces that it has imposed an over ten million euro fine on the Cologne-based dealer cooperative Zweirad-Einkaufs-Genossenschaft eG (ZEG).

    Herrmans Has New Owners

    PIETARSAARI, Finland - Sponsor Capital has acquired the majority of the shares of Herrmans; the Finnish producer of bicycle components and heavy-duty light solutions. The new owner of the company is to support future growth and to further strengthen Herrmans' market position and competitive advantages.

    Enviolo Brings Updated Cargobike Gear Hub

    AMSTERDAM, the Netherlands - Enviolo has redesigned its cargo stepless shifting system to cater for the increasing cargobike market. For MY2020, the heavy-duty groupset will be only available in a single piece axle version at a 10x135 dropout variant, simplifying the mounting process for bicycle manufacturers.

    Accell Group Acquires (E-) Cargo Bikes Specialist

    Accell Group increased its minority stake in Velosophy B.V. from 35 to 100 percent. Velosophy, owner of among them Babboe, is a fast-growing innovative player in e-cargo bike solutions for consumers and the business market.

    Roxim's Smallest Speed Pedelec Front Light

    TAIPEI, Taiwan - Roxim Technologies, Inc. has successfully integrated both high and low beams into a small sized front light, the 'Z4E Pro'. This new front light complies with ECE R113 class B regulation.
